python創建文件打開文件讀寫文件?1. 創建文件/打開文件,接下來我們就來聊聊關于python創建文件打開文件讀寫文件?以下内容大家不妨參考一二希望能幫到您!
python創建文件打開文件讀寫文件
Python筆記 創建、打開、編輯、讀取、删除文件1. 創建文件/打開文件
用open()創建或者打開文件并創建一個文件對象,用close()關閉文件,文件打開後一定要關閉。
In [1]:
f = open('Python筆記 文件讀寫.txt', 'w') #以'w'模式打開'Python筆記 文件讀寫.txt',如果文件存在則清空文件打開,如果文件不存在就創建一這個文件
In [2]:
print (f) <_io.TextIOWrapper name='Python筆記 文件讀寫.txt' mode='w' encoding='cp936'>
In [3]:
f.close()
In [4]:
f.closed
Out[4]:
True
2. 用with open() as f: 安全打開文件
用with open() as file: 語句打開文件,會自動在打開文件後關閉文件,不用手動關閉,比較安全。但必須保證文件存在,否則出錯。
In [5]:
f = open('Python筆記 文件讀寫with-as.txt','w') with open('Python筆記 文件讀寫with-as.txt') as f: data = f.read()
In [6]:
data
Out[6]:
''
In [7]:
f.closed
Out[7]:
True
3. 寫文件 f.write()
用f.write()向已打開的文件中寫入字符串,返回寫入的字符數。寫之前文件須打開。
In [8]:
f = open('Python筆記 文件讀寫write.txt','w')
In [9]:
f.write('這是第一行\n')
Out[9]:
python 文件操作
,